Drink with a View
Along the shore of the harbor sit a number of quaint restaurants that offer some of the freshest seafood and best views of the harbor and Aegean Sea you could ask for. In the distance is Castle of St. Peter, built in 1402 by the Knights of Saint John, early Catholic military crusaders.
With long lines and a storm looming, we decided not to tour the castle, which I've heard houses a wonderful nautical museum.
